Drone is high and moving while focused on fixed point on ground, balloon drifts thru field of view in opposite direction and so looks faster than it really is. The geometry is visually deceptive though really quite simple.

People don't understand that the vast majority of UFO behaviour is actually just the camera being unstable and jerking around a bit or a parallax effect caused by a moving and rotating camera pointing at a static object.

The famous "GIMBAL" UFO video on YouTube is just the backside of a jet and you are seeing the engine exhaust including glare.
